well gimpo wonderland is advertising for teachers at present.
conditions are

Quote:
- Salary : 2 million krw/m (Before Tax)
- Teaching Hours : 150 hrs/m
- 1 million krw bonus after 1 year contract
- Vacation 2 weeks( summer and winter respectively)
- American accent and those already in Korea preferred


they don't seem to be providing airfare and I think that they have decied to halve the severance payment unless the bonus is paid on top of it.
